@charset "UTF-8";@keyframes open{0%{height:100vh}to{height:0%}}@media screen and (max-width:991px){.p-nishikamata-kv img{object-position:bottom}}@media screen and (max-width:767px){.p-nishikamata-kv{height:85svh}}@media screen and (max-width:767px){.p-nishikamata-merit{margin-top:85svh}}.p-nishikamata__lead--lg{font-size:clamp(1.8rem,2vw,2.4rem);display:block}.p-nishikamata__lead .inline-block{display:inline-block}.p-bukken-merit__box .p-nishikamata-center{text-align:center}.p-bukken-merit__box span{line-height:1.5}.p-bukken-merit__box span.fs28{font-size:clamp(2.2rem,1.5599569429rem + .6458557589vw,2.8rem)}.p-nishikamata-project__button-cv{max-width:928px;margin-inline:auto;margin-top:var(--vw-size56);display:flex;justify-content:center;gap:var(--vw-size24)}@media screen and (max-width:991px){.p-nishikamata-project__button-cv{margin-inline:var(--vw-size25);margin-top:var(--vw-size40);gap:var(--vw-size16)}}@media screen and (max-width:767px){.p-nishikamata-project__button-cv .c-btn--cv--vacant,.p-nishikamata-project__button-cv .c-btn--cv--contact{min-width:var(--vw-size120)}}
